Leading Global Internet Company, Netex Launches Springo Into U.S. Market

Springo Signals Evolution in Navigating the Web


NEW YORK, NY--(Marketwire - April 21, 2010) - Netex Ltd. (TELAVIV: NTX), a global Internet company that creates innovative Web navigation solutions, with proven expertise as the most popular service of its kind in Israel, today announced the public Beta availability of Springo (www.springo.com). Springo is an Internet navigation and discovery service that enhances traditional search. With its suite of innovative tools, Springo directs users to specialized websites that best support their needs, instead of searching for specific content.

According to Netcraft research, there are over 200 million live websites with additional sites published every day; as the Internet continues to grow, it has become increasingly challenging to navigate. Whereas traditional search engines generate a mix of digital content, Springo filters through the Internet and guides users to specialized websites, expertly organized by popularity and topic.

Leveraging Netex's U.S. patents and backend algorithm, Springo analyzes and ranks websites according to the activity of the Internet user community, reflective of user preferences and unbiased by SEO enhancements. A smart solution, the service garners insight from real-time Internet community traffic. With an increased user base, Springo will evolve further, developing innovative products designed to meet the community's needs.

Springo offers users three tools designed to accommodate their individual style of browsing the Internet:

  • The Springo Visual Navigation Solution utilizes a visual interface to render a navigation path to the most desirable websites. Supporting Web navigation with Narrow and Expand options, the Visual Navigation Solution presents clearly the most visited websites for all topics and queries.
  • The Springo Homepage is an entry point for users to surf the Internet, offering customizable settings and quick links to the most useful and frequented websites.
  • Springo Express is an unobtrusive Internet browser add-on that enriches the browser with various navigational functionalities.
    • Utilizing a visual display, Springo Express offers users relevant top websites to complement their traditional search results.
    • Direct navigation from the browser address bar sends users to their desired websites simply by entering a site's name or topic rather than URL.
    • Additionally, Springo Express recognizes the website currently visited and suggests similar websites that likely also address the user's needs.

About Netex Ltd.

Netex Ltd. (TELAVIV: NTX) is a global Internet company that develops innovative Web navigation solutions. The company operates Netex.co.il, the number one Internet navigation service in Israel, and Springo.com in the U.S., as well as powers Au.ru in Russia. Founded in 1999 and listed on the Tel Aviv Stock Exchange in 2006, the company is headquartered in Hod HaSharon, Israel, and has business operations in Israel, the U.S., and Russia. In 2009, Netex was awarded several patents, including the U.S. WWW addressing patent for direct navigation services on the Web. For more information, visit www.netexcorp.com.
